液体散货码头大直径工艺管道应力分析

摘    要:随着液体散货码头建设步伐加快、泊位吨级大型化、管道直径加大,进行管道应力分析对于判定油品码头管道布置的合理性、经济性和安全性起着至关重要的作用。结合工程实例采用CAESAR II管道应力分析软件论述管道布置、一次应力、二次应力和管道补偿方式等,为同类码头设计提供借鉴经验。

关 键 词:液体散货码头  管道应力  管道补偿

Abstract:With the rapid construction of liquid bulk cargo docks,the berth tonnage grows and the diameter of pipeline increases,so it is very important to carry out the stress analysis so as to judge the reasonability,economicalness and safety of the pipelines'arrangement.This paper expounds software CAESAR II,which is utilized to analyze the piping layout,the primary stress,the secondary stress and the pipeline compensation mode,etc.
